Major Lake Species:  Lake Trout, Smallmouth Bass, Northern Pike, Yellow Perch, Whitefish

Lake Facts:

  • Lake Manitou is located on Manitoulin Island, north of South Baymouth and south of Little Current
  • co-ordinates: Lat. 45° 46′ 39″ Long. 81° 59′ 00″
  • Lake Manitou is the largest lake on Manitoulin Island
  • while the lake reaches maximum depths of 161′, the average depth is 49′
  • the perimeter of the lake is 100 km (62 miles)
  • the surface area is 10,460 hectares(25,848 acres)
  • the lake has limestone bedrock and is spring fed. Its clear waters drive fish slightly deeper than one might expect
  • there is a good public boat launch located at Sanfield which is found on the southeast end of the lake along Hwy. 542
  • the fishing regulations of Fisheries Management Zone 10 apply to Lake Manitou
